A man has suffered injuries to his arm in an assault in Weymouth town centre.

Officers from Dorset Police were called to a man who had been found with an injury to his arm at a taxi rank in Westham Road in Weymouth.

Following enquiries, it was reported that the injured man – aged in his 20s – had been assaulted by a man who was known to him outside Snookes bar in Caroline Place.

The injured man did not require immediate hospital treatment, according police.

Officers from Dorset Police  have only just released the information surrounding the assault which took place at 11.10pm on Saturday, June 29.

They are now appealing for witnesses or anyone with information to come forward.

Police Constable Chloe Seaward, of Weymouth and Portland police, said: “We are carrying out a number of enquiries into this incident and I am keen to hear from anyone with information that might assist our enquiries.

“I understand there were a number of other people in the area at the time of the assault and I would urge anyone who saw what happened to please contact us.

“Finally, I would like to hear from anyone who has captured any relevant footage, either on dashcam or home CCTV.”
